A pension transfer essentially involves transferring your money from one pension plan to another. There are a variety of reasons why you might consider a pension transfer. One common reason is to consolidate multiple pension plans under a single scheme, simplifying your pension management. You might also consider such a transfer if it could benefit you in terms of enhanced services or improved pension growth. In any case, understanding the potential implications of pension transfers requires a deep knowledge of pension schemes, tax legislation, and financial markets. The pension transfer financial advisor starts by assessing your overall financial position and desired retirement lifestyle. They ascertain your risk tolerance and provide relevant market insights. They will also analyse your existing pension scheme to evaluate whether a transfer would be beneficial. This is performed by considering your specific circumstances and the features, benefits, costs, and risks associated with your current and prospective pension scheme.

A pension transfer financial advisor will also guide you through the rules and regulations surrounding pension transfer. Financial legislation can be intricate and subject to change, so having an expert on hand to understand the implications of these changes can be invaluable.

The potential benefits of a pension transfer can be significant. These might include more flexible access to your money, the ability to pass leftover pension to your heirs, or potentially better growth or income prospects. However, there are also risks involved, such as potentially lower guaranteed income, exposure to volatile markets, and other costs.
